Transaction 0359cc4e3261ed20f12a9d7ef9f1fb649535198fa0d1a4b5acd875c671d1c51e

2 Input
2 Outputs
  • 0359cc4e3261ed20f12a9d7ef9f1fb649535198fa0d1a4b5acd875c671d1c51e:0
  • value  6620000
    address  13pLz4z6chXNbC1gAA3ibGGuF8YxFVinxK
  • 0359cc4e3261ed20f12a9d7ef9f1fb649535198fa0d1a4b5acd875c671d1c51e:1
  • value  150000000
    address  1ME3V7GLTrhivNQCnsq9MY8RkugbUdCCQc